This purple furoshiki wrapping cloth features a white rabbit happily jumping around on the grass. The jumping rabbit is said to symbolize leaps and bounds, plenty of children, fertility, and prosperity.
The fabric is made using a traditional technique called chirimen, which creates a distinctive, uneven texture and makes it easy to wrap. It is also favored for its durability and the convenience of being washable at home.
Purple is traditionally considered a noble color in Japan, as high-ranking people have been wearing purple items for a long time. The purple furoshiki is a suitable color for use at celebrations such as marriage and childbirth, or when you want to express your gratitude.

Yamada Sen-i was founded in 1937 as a Kyoto-based wholesaler of furoshiki, or Japanese wrapping cloths. Today, the company is one among the dwindling numbers of makers specializing in furoshiki. They see it as their duty to share furoshiki with the next generation, viewing this craft as a continuously developing living culture that has and continues to nurture the heart of Japan. Yamada Sen-i both develops new products and restores old designs, bringing this unique Japanese craft to the world.
